How much do angular develop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for angular developer in Garland, TX is $56.51,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$50.87 and $62.26 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Is an Angular developer a good career?

An Angular developer is a valuable role in web development, focusing on building dynamic single-page applications using the Angular framework. The demand for Angular developers remains strong due to the popularity of Angular for enterprise and large-scale projects, and it often requires knowledge of TypeScript, HTML, and CSS. Career growth can be supported by gaining experience with related tools like RxJS and Angular CLI, along with continuous learning of new Angular features and best practices.

How do Angular developers typically collaborate with UX/UI designers during a project?

Angular Developers often work closely with UX/UI designers to ensure that the application's interface is both visually appealing and functionally robust. This collaboration usually involves regular meetings to discuss design mockups, user flows, and interactive elements. Developers provide feedback on technical feasibility while designers clarify user experience goals, leading to iterative improvements. Effective communication and a shared understanding of project objectives are key to successfully integrating design and development efforts.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Angular developer?

To thrive as an Angular Developer, you need a solid understanding of JavaScript, TypeScript, web development fundamentals, and experience with Angular frameworks, often backed by a relevant computer science deg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with tools like Angular CLI, RESTful APIs, Git, and testing frameworks such as Jasmine or Karma is common, and certifications in web development can be advantageous.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help developers excel in collaborative, fast-paced environments. These skills enable efficient development of scalable, maintainable web applications and ensure alignment with project requirements and team goals.

What does an Angular developer do?

An Angular Developer is a software professional who specializes in building web applications using the Angular framework. They are responsible for designing and implementing user interfaces, writing clean and efficient code, and ensuring the application is responsive and performs well across different devices. Angular Developers often collaborate with backend developers, designers, and other team members to create seamless and dynamic web experiences. Their role also includes debugging, testing, and maintaining applications to ensure they meet user needs and business requirements.
